There will be different priorities for different immigration cases.
Every profession will qualify anyway, but there will be a list of high-demand occupations to be used to assign higher priority to a number of cases.
So applicants should expect to encounter very different processing times depending on their profession.
Further case processing instructions are expected by the end of 2008.
